Recognizing When to Do CPR

One of the very first steps in any kind of emergency situation is identifying when CPR is necessary:

    Unresponsiveness: If your child isn't reacting or moving. No Breathing: If your baby isn't breathing generally or at all. Abnormal Skin Color: A blue tint around lips or face indicates lack of oxygen.

The Steps to Execute Infant CPR

Performing CPR on a newborn varies substantially from adults because of their size and frailty:

1. Positioning

Lay the baby on their back on a firm surface.

2. Opening Airway

Gently turn the head back slightly to open the airway while guaranteeing not to overextend it.

3. Check Breathing

Look for chest movements and pay attention for breath seems for around 10 seconds.

4. Chest Compressions

Using 2 fingers positioned simply below the nipple line, lower approximately 1/3 deepness of their chest (regarding 1-1.5 inches) at a price of 100-120 compressions per minute.

5. Rescue Breaths

After every 30 compressions, give 2 mild rescue breaths:

    Seal your lips around their mouth and nose, Deliver each breath over one secondly while observing for breast increase, Repeat up until you see indications of life or help arrives.

Common Blunders During Infant CPR

Even well-intentioned efforts might falter as a result of common blunders:

    Applying too much pressure during compressions can create injury. Failing to make sure proper head tilt may block airflow. Not calling for help early enough can delay important care.
